USCT Port, also known as USCT PAD, is a Senegalese basketball team based in Dakar. It currently plays in the Nationale 1, after promoting from the second division in 2021. [1] It is the basketball team of the Autonomous Port of Dakar.

DUC Dakar

Dakar Université Club Basketball, also known as DUC Dakar, is a Senegalese basketball club based in Dakar. It is the basketball team of the Cheikh Anta Diop University. The team plays in the Nationale 1 and has won the league five times, its last being in 2021. Established in 1956, the team was founded as a basketball club and later became a multisports club, including football, athletics and more.
